Output d5963c44ee4c364b60b742da5d8fc20c835ff39e59d80b8c6e04ae3f965520d0:28

value
297339
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 a6eff5809b4b1e5118945f153089981f94f5eabb OP_EQUALVERIFY OP_CHECKSIG
address
1GDgdVFL6o9er1B8bExXphzBMiovn8uBEh
transaction
d5963c44ee4c364b60b742da5d8fc20c835ff39e59d80b8c6e04ae3f965520d0
confirmations
341103
spent
true